Ukraine is on the verge of introducing a transport blockade of Transnistria
On Sunday, August 29, Ukrainian customs officials denied information about the postponement of the ban on the movement of cars with the registration of Transnistria. It was previously noted that permission to enter vehicles from this region without neutral registration numbers and MD stickers will be extended until January 10 next year.
Thus, Ukraine is actually on the verge of introducing a transport blockade of Transnistria.
Meanwhile, in Odessa it was reported that the data on the postponement of the ban on the admission of cars with Transnistrian registration without neutral numbers to participate in traffic between the countries was posted by mistake. At the checkpoint of the Kuchurgan customs of Ukraine, they noted that no instructions were received to ban the movement of cars.
For the first time, Chisinau appealed to Kiev regarding a ban on the movement of vehicles with registration data from Transnistria at the beginning of last year. Taraspol promised to take similar measures in response to Moldova. The introduction of restrictions was postponed.
At the August 11 meeting of Maia Sandu with the Deputy Head of the Presidential Administration of the Russian Federation Dmitry Kozak, the head of the Moldovan state stressed that no unilateral restrictive measures would be taken against Transnistria. Tiraspol doubted Sandu's words, but noted their readiness for fruitful work with Chisinau.
